Home excavation services involve the process of preparing and altering the land around a property to meet specific needs. This work typically includes tasks such as digging trenches, removing soil or debris, leveling the ground, and creating foundations for construction projects. Whether installing a new driveway, building a retaining wall, or preparing a yard for landscaping, excavation is a crucial step in ensuring the site is properly prepared for future use. Skilled contractors use specialized equipment to carry out these tasks efficiently and accurately, helping to set the stage for a successful project.
These services help address a variety of common problems homeowners encounter. For example, poorly graded yards can lead to drainage issues and water pooling during heavy rains. Excavation can correct these problems by reshaping the terrain to promote proper water flow away from the home. Additionally, excavation is often necessary when removing old or unstable soil, making way for new landscaping, patios, or foundations. It can also be used to dig out areas for underground utilities or septic systems, ensuring that these critical components are installed safely and correctly.

The overview below groups typical Home Excavation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Reno, NV.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or excavation work, such as trenching or small site prep, often range from $250 to $600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, with fewer projects reaching the higher end of the scale.
Driveway or Patio Excavation - Larger projects like driveway removal or patio prep usually cost between $1,000 and $3,000. These jobs are common for local contractors handling medium-sized outdoor projects.
Full Site Preparation - Complete excavation for new construction or large landscaping can range from $3,500 to $10,000+, depending on the scope and site conditions. Larger, more complex projects tend to push into the higher tiers of this range.
Specialized or Complex Projects - Extremely detailed or challenging excavations, such as hillside work or utility installation, can exceed $10,000 and may vary widely based on complexity. These are less common but require experienced local pros to handle intricate site conditions.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
